Output efcc62618733027f0ae7a42743f49d476668f8bee06b1afe42e70d08d7416e18:1

value
101000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69923c41aa1e9d22a69750ec2cebc975797f776c OP_EQUAL
address
3BKE4JEx2wSeC3E1xNg4V1YaBBmFoGYEmo
transaction
efcc62618733027f0ae7a42743f49d476668f8bee06b1afe42e70d08d7416e18
spent
true